The Beal Booster III 9.7 mm is designed for sport climbing and mixed conditions, with a length of 80 m. The Unicore treatment connects the sheath to the core for better resistance to punctures and wear. The Dry Cover treatment offers improved resistance to moisture, abrasion, and external aggressions. With a low impact force of approximately 7.3-7.4 kN, it effectively absorbs falls. Weighing around 61-63 g/m and featuring a dynamic elongation of approximately 38%, it is lightweight and easy to handle. The Unicore technology securely bonds the sheath to the core, enhancing durability and safety without compromising flexibility. The Dry Cover treatment significantly improves resistance to moisture, friction, and dirt, prolonging the rope's lifespan and maintaining performance in wet or snowy conditions. As a single rope, the Booster III has a low shock force and a high UIAA fall rating (7 to 9), ensuring good fall absorption for experienced climbers and intensive use. Key specifications include a diameter of 9.7 mm, a length of 80 m, a manufacturer weight of approximately 61-63 g/m, dynamic elongation of approximately 38%, and a visible center marking. Highly abrasion-resistant, it is suitable for rock climbing and mixed/snow terrain. The Booster III stands out for its pleasant handling and compactness, offering a good balance between lightweight, comfort, and robustness for sport climbing, long routes, and demanding environments.
